>> Nice. I now have a:
>>
>> Linux nas3 5.15.14-200.fc35.aarch64 (NB. 14 instead of 13)
>>
>> running headless and fully up to date wrt. dnf on the (presumably) newer build standard of rpi4 4GB.
>>
>> The only oddity is that now the red LED that used to go off during booting now stays on permanently. Is that a deliberate change of policy?
> No it's a bug that hit upstream, I thought it was fixed in 5.15.14 but
> maybe it's 5.15.15, I don't remember off hand, it landed at the last
> moment in 5.16 GA

the bugfix was in 5.15.14, but in the DTB not in the kernel itself.
